在互联网时代,网页设计成为了一个非常重要的技能。无论是个人网站、企业官网,还是电子商务平台,网页设计的质量直接影响用户体验及网站的整体效果。然而,对于很多初学者来说,制作一个漂亮而实用的网页常常是一项挑战。在这里,我们将分享一些免费源代码资源,帮助你在期末作业中提升网页设计技能。
网页设计的基础知识
在复制与修改源代码之前,我们首先需要了解网页设计的基本概念。网页设计是指通过HTML、CSS、JavaScript等技术,构建网页的视觉效果及用户交互体验。熟悉这些技术是成功完成期末作业的基石。让我们深入探讨这三种基础技术。
HTML(超文本标记语言)
HTML是构建网页的基础语言。它用于创建网页的结构,通过标记来定义各个元素,如标题、段落、链接、图片等。掌握HTML的基本标签和其用法是学习网页设计的第一步。
CSS(层叠样式表)
CSS的主要作用是控制网页的视觉呈现。通过CSS,你可以设置字体、颜色、布局和其他样式,使网页更加美观。CSS的灵活性可以极大提升网站的用户体验,是实现网页设计美感的重要工具。
JavaScript(JS)
JavaScript是一种编程语言,用于实现网页的动态效果和交互功能。通过JS,可以使网页响应用户的操作,比如表单验证、动态内容更新等。了解JavaScript将使你能够创建更具吸引力的网页。
免费源代码资源的获取
在学习网页设计的过程中,查找高质量的免费源代码是非常有帮助的。幸运的是,网络上有许多网站提供丰富的源代码资源,以供学生及开发者使用。以下是几个推荐的网站:
Github 作为全球最大的开源代码托管平台,Github上有大量的网页设计开源项目。用户可以搜索特定关键词,找到所需的网页设计模板和组件。
CodePen CodePen是一个前端开发者的社交平台,用户可以在上面分享、编辑和生成HTML、CSS和JavaScript代码。你可以浏览其他用户的作品,获得灵感或直接复制使用。
Bootstrap Bootstrap是一个广泛使用的前端框架,提供了一系列可重用的组件和样式。通过它的官方网站,你可以下载样式表和JavaScript文件,并根据自己的需求进行修改。
W3Schools W3Schools不仅提供了丰富的学习资料,还有许多免费的网页模板。你可以从中找到灵感,并将其用于自己的期末作业。
借鉴与修改源代码
获取免费源代码后,如何正确使用它们是另一个关键问题。首先,要学会借鉴。可以选择一些自己喜欢的模板,仔细研究其结构和样式,了解其实现方式。随后,可以基于这些模板进行个性化修改。确保修改后的网页具有自己的风格,避免直接复制粘贴,从而提升学习效果。
提高代码质量
在完成源代码的修改后,检查代码的质量同样重要。你可以使用一些工具来规范你的代码,比如Lint工具,这种工具可以帮助你检测出代码中的错误和不规范之处,确保网页的兼容性和性能。
创建一个简单的网页
为了更好地理解理论知识,下面将通过一个简单的实例来讲解如何使用HTML、CSS和JavaScript构建一个基本网页。
代码示例
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link rel="stylesheet" href="styles.css">
<title>我的网页设计作业</title>
</head>
<body>
<header>
<h1>欢迎来到我的网页设计作业</h1>
</header>
<main>
<section>
<h2>关于我</h2>
<p>我是一个网页设计爱好者,正在学习如何制作网站。</p>
</section>
<section>
<h2>我的作品</h2>
<ul>
<li>作品1</li>
<li>作品2</li>
<li>作品3</li>
</ul>
</section>
</main>
<footer>
<p>© 2023 我的名字. 保留所有权利.</p>
</footer>
</body>
</html>
CSS示例
body {
font-family: Arial, sans-serif;
line-height: 1.6;
}
header {
background: #4CAF50;
color: white;
padding: 10px 0;
text-align: center;
}
main {
padding: 20px;
}
footer {
text-align: center;
padding: 10px 0;
background: #333;
color: white;
}
JavaScript示例
document.addEventListener('DOMContentLoaded', () => {
alert('欢迎来到我的网页设计作业!');
});
在上述示例中,我们创建了一个简单的网页结构,使用了基本的HTML、CSS和JavaScript。通过这种方式,你不仅能够掌握各类技术,还能为自己的期末作业增添几分色彩。
总结与展望
网页设计不仅是一个技能,更是一种艺术。通过不断地学习、实践和借鉴,你将能够在这个领域内不断提升自己。在期末作业中,源代码的应用将大大提高你的效率和创意。希望以上分享的资源和技巧能够帮助你顺利完成网页设计的期末作业,尽情展现你的能力与创意。